AAT Visa Refusal Appeal: A Step-by-Step Guide

Navigating an Administrative Appeals Tribunal (AAT) visa rejection can feel daunting , but understanding the steps is critical. Here’s a straightforward guide to assist you through the review of your visa decision . Initially, meticulously examine the explanations provided for the initial visa denial . Next, gather all pertinent documents, including evidence supporting your circumstances. This might involve securing character evaluations , banking statements, or job history. You'll then need to file a formal application to the AAT, paying the stipulated amount. The AAT will review your appeal and may ask for further details from you. Be willing to attend a session – though a documented presentation is often possible . Finally, anticipate the AAT’s decision, and think about your options afterward, which may include additional legal advice .

Typical Causes for Applicant Visa Denials & How to Contest

Many seekers face unsuccessful outcomes when applying for an AAT visa, and understanding the frequent reasons behind these outcomes is vital. Often, denials stem from insufficient documentation proving eligibility under the AAT guidelines, inability to fulfill the necessary financial conditions, a assessment of ineligibility based on previous immigration history, or concerns related to criminal background. If your petition is rejected, don't be discouraged; you possess the opportunity to contest the outcome. The appeal process usually involves presenting supplementary proof to resolve the first arguments raised by the AAT. It's highly advised to obtain expert legal support to properly navigate the review process and maximize your chances of a successful result.
